The Georgetown Chamber of Commerce and Industry (GCCI) strongly condemns the incursion of Guyana’s  Exclusive Economic Zone (EEZ) by a Venezuelan naval vessel. This threat to our country’s sovereign territory  must be rejected and such acts of aggression must not be allowed to continue with impunity.  

The Chamber urges all nations and international organisations to reject these threats to the region’s security and  stability. Venezuela’s rejection of this long-established international boundary—which was determined by the 1899  Arbitral Award—is currently before the International Court of Justice. This continuous escalation of aggressions  and threats by the Bolivarian Republic of Venezuela only serves to destroy the peace enjoyed in the region.

The GCCI will support the Government of Guyana in any measures taken to protect the country’s sovereign  territory. It is also imperative that citizens maintain unity in condemning these actions and reject narratives that  aim to usurp our territorial integrity. The Essequibo region belongs to Guyana, and the Chamber affirms that it is  Guyana’s right to occupy its 83,000 square miles and EEZ.
